I have a 1992 ford escort wagon 1.9 liter. has 147000 miles.
Been a good car, and I have noticed that on my way to work the transmission has been popping out of over drive. This only happens when I nearly get to work about 20 miles away, and when I am nearly home. When I first leave both directions it works fine. But when I am nearly home or at work it seems like it pops out of over drive. I will be going about 60 mph then all of a sudden rpms go up so I assume its poping out of overdrive. IF I drive it around town I don't have problems but when I go a long distance it only seems to stay in over drive until the car warms up good. Once the car is warmed up to normal temp the tranny pops in and out of over drive.
Today was actually the first day I got off at my exit after the car popped out of over drive and it would not start back at 1st. I had to stop the car put it in park then the tranny started over. I have not tried driving all the way to work in just regualar D because my gas mileage would suffer without overdrive. Does it sound like my tranny is dying?
Are used trannys expensive or is it hard to rebuild one?
